¿Cuál es una representación gráfica de una derivación?

6. _____________ es una representación gráfica de una derivación. Explicación: el árbol de análisis es una representación de la derivación.

¿Cuál es la representación gráfica de una gramática?

9. __________ es la representación gráfica acíclica de una gramática. Explicación: Para representar gráficamente una derivación de una gramática necesitamos usar árboles de análisis sintáctico.

¿Qué atributo se puede calcular a partir de los valores de los atributos en los hermanos y el padre de ese nodo?

Los atributos heredados son valores que se calculan en un nodo N en un árbol de análisis a partir de los valores de atributo del padre de N, los hermanos de N y el propio N. Un SDD tiene atributo L si cada atributo se sintetiza o se hereda del padre o de la izquierda.

¿Qué árbol es una representación gráfica de una derivación?

Un árbol de análisis (también conocido como árbol de derivación) es una representación gráfica que muestra cómo se derivan las cadenas en un idioma utilizando la gramática del idioma.

¿Qué derivación genera el analizador de arriba hacia abajo?

Un analizador de arriba hacia abajo se denomina analizador LL porque analiza la entrada de izquierda a derecha y construye una derivación más a la izquierda de la oración.

¿Qué explican los analizadores de arriba hacia abajo?

De Wikipedia, la enciclopedia libre. El análisis de arriba hacia abajo en informática es una estrategia de análisis en la que primero se mira el nivel más alto del árbol de análisis y se trabaja hacia abajo del árbol de análisis utilizando las reglas de reescritura de una gramática formal. Los analizadores LL son un tipo de analizador que utiliza una estrategia de análisis de arriba hacia abajo.

¿Cuál de los siguientes analizadores es el más potente?

Explicación: Canonical LR es el analizador más potente en comparación con otros analizadores LR.

¿Qué es el árbol de derivación con el ejemplo?

El árbol de derivación es una representación gráfica para la derivación de las reglas de producción dadas de la gramática libre de contexto (CFG). Es una forma de mostrar cómo se puede hacer la derivación para obtener una cadena a partir de un conjunto dado de reglas de producción. También se le llama árbol de Parse.

¿El árbol de derivación y el árbol de análisis son iguales?

3 respuestas. AFAIK, “árbol de derivación” y “árbol de análisis” son lo mismo. En informática, un árbol de sintaxis abstracta (AST), o simplemente árbol de sintaxis, es una representación de árbol de la estructura sintáctica abstracta del código fuente escrito en un lenguaje de programación.

¿Qué es una derivación por la izquierda?

Derivación más a la izquierda: se obtiene una derivación más a la izquierda aplicando la producción a la variable más a la izquierda en cada paso. Derivación más a la derecha: se obtiene una derivación más a la derecha aplicando la producción a la variable más a la derecha en cada paso.

¿Cuál es tipo de lexema?

Explicación: El análisis léxico identifica diferentes unidades léxicas en un código fuente. 9. ¿Cuál es un tipo de Lexema?
Explicación: Todos ellos junto con los Operadores son diferentes tipos de lexemas.

¿Qué es la salida de la herramienta Lex?

Lex es un programa de computadora que genera analizadores léxicos y fue escrito por Mike Lesk y Eric Schmidt. Lex lee un flujo de entrada que especifica el analizador léxico y genera el código fuente que implementa el lexer en el lenguaje de programación C.

¿Es una representación gráfica de una derivación Mcq?

6. _____________ es una representación gráfica de una derivación. Explicación: el árbol de análisis es una representación de la derivación.

¿Qué es una representación gráfica de un algoritmo?

Un diagrama de flujo es una representación pictórica (gráfica) de un algoritmo.

¿Qué hace que una gramática sea regular?

Gramática regular: una gramática es regular si tiene reglas de la forma A -> a o A -> aB o A -> ɛ donde ɛ es un símbolo especial llamado NULL. Lenguajes regulares: un lenguaje es regular si se puede expresar en términos de expresiones regulares. Por ejemplo, (a+b*)* y (a+b)* generan el mismo idioma.

¿Cuáles son los dos tipos de gramática lineal?

Esta gramática puede ser de dos formas: Gramática Regular Lineal Recta. Gramática regular lineal izquierda.

¿Cómo se deriva un árbol de análisis?

Árbol de análisis | Derivaciones | autómatas

Ejemplo- Considere la siguiente gramática-
Derivación más a la izquierda- S → aB.
Ejemplo- Considere la siguiente gramática-
Derivación más a la derecha- S → aB.
Derivación más a la izquierda- S → bB.
Derivación más a la derecha- S → bB.
árbol de análisis-
Derivación más a la izquierda-

¿Cómo encuentro un árbol de análisis?

Árbol de análisis:

El árbol de análisis es la representación jerárquica de terminales o no terminales.
Estos símbolos (terminales o no terminales) representan la derivación de la gramática para generar cadenas de entrada.
En el análisis, la cadena salta usando el símbolo de inicio.

¿Qué es el árbol de derivación único?

Una gramática no es ambigua si hay una única derivación más a la izquierda para cada cadena en el lenguaje. De manera equivalente, para cada cadena hay un árbol de derivación único. Por ejemplo, nuestra gramática para la igualdad es ambigua: S → 0S1S | 1S0S | ε (La cadena 0101 tiene dos árboles de derivación).

¿Qué es el inglés de derivación?

Actualizado el 04 de febrero de 2020. En morfología, la derivación es el proceso de crear una nueva palabra a partir de una palabra anterior, generalmente agregando un prefijo o un sufijo. La palabra proviene del latín, “to draw off”, y su forma adjetival es derivativa.

¿Qué es la forma oracional?

Una forma oracional es cualquier cadena derivable del símbolo de inicio. Así, en la derivación de a + a * a , E + T * F y E + F * a y F + a * a son todas formas oracionales como lo son E y a + a * a ellas mismas. Frase. Una oración es una forma oracional que consta únicamente de terminales como a + a * a.

¿Qué es una secuencia de derivación?

secuencia de derivación En la teoría del lenguaje formal, una secuencia de palabras de la forma w 1 ⇒ w 2 ⇒ … ⇒ w n. (para la notación, consulte el sistema semi-Thue). Para una gramática libre de contexto, tal secuencia está más a la izquierda (o más a la derecha) si, para cada 1←i←n, w i+1 se obtiene de w i reescribiendo el no terminal más a la izquierda (o más a la derecha) en w i.

¿Cuál de los siguientes es el método de paso más poderoso?

CLR es el método de análisis más potente.

¿Cuántas partes del compilador hay?

La estructura de un compilador Un compilador consta de tres partes principales: el frontend, el middle-end y el backend. El front-end verifica si el programa está escrito correctamente en términos de sintaxis y semántica del lenguaje de programación.

¿Por qué CLR es más poderoso?

Cuando el analizador mira hacia adelante en el búfer de entrada para decidir si la reducción debe realizarse o no, la información sobre los terminales está disponible en el estado del propio analizador, lo que no ocurre en el caso del estado del analizador SLR. Por lo tanto, el analizador CLR(1) es más poderoso que SLR.